揭秘百万年薪岗量化私募C++开发面试,究竟在考什么?

C++ 语言深度(基础与进阶),这是重中之重,面试官会深入考察你是否真正理解C++而不仅仅是会用。

A.内存管理🎯

 new/delete 和 malloc/free 的区别、内存对齐(alignment)、内存碎片、智能指针(unique_ptr, shared_ptr, weak_ptr 的原理、使用场景和陷阱)。

B.对象模型🎯

 虚函数表(vtable/vptr)机制、多重继承下的内存布局、RTTI(运行时类型识别)。

C.常量正确性🎯

const 关键字在各类场景下的应用(成员函数、指针、引用等)。

D.引用与指针🎯

左值引用、右值引用(&&)、移动语义(move semantics)、完美转发(perfect forwarding)的原理和优势。这是高频考点,因为能极大提升性能。

E.模板编程🎯

函数模板、类模板、模板特化、变参模板。可能会问到模板元编程(TMP)的基本概念,如类型萃取(type traits)。

F.STL 深度使用与实现🎯

不仅要知道怎么用,更要了解其底层实现和复杂度。

std::vector 的动态增长机制及如何优化。

std::unordered_map 与 std::map 的底层实现(哈希表 vs 红黑树)及各自的适用场景。

#私募量化# #交易系统开发# #九坤 #佳期# #cpp#
#optiver# #上海交通大学# #浙江大学#
全部评论
C++低延迟交易系统开发笔记,推荐电脑端打开语雀版。 语雀:https://www.yuque.com/bluememories/lanaff/eud01pmbglsxf6gu github:https://github.com/zzxscodes/trading-system-notes/blob/main/README.md
1 回复 分享
发布于 04-09 00:01 广东
原文戳这里哈: 揭秘百万年薪岗量化私募C++开发面试,究竟在考什么? https://mp.weixin.qq.com/s/kXsrKCsHrYIV4TMU0S3a-Q
点赞 回复 分享
发布于 2025-09-25 16:59 广东

相关推荐

04-18 03:40
已编辑
大连工业大学 C工程师
各位大佬,双非本2硕机械,研一,做无人机导航方向⭐情况说明:摆烂组里做的是经验学习相关,上学期让我们研究了好久视觉slam和相关的论文50来篇,由于刷到了几个slam面感觉slam岗位太少学历太低门槛太高了,我只会视觉slam十四讲那本书上的内容其他的什么也不懂,于是选了导航(复杂场景无人机自主探索),本想结合一下vla之类但是想的太简单,个人能力也不够(有408的底子但是只有点理论能力,c++和py学过但是也纯小白,linux目前复杂的只能靠ai来操作,ros也只看了b站阿杰的入门课程,修改开源项目完全依赖ai),看了十几篇vln的论文感觉组内能给的支持也少,说了一下组内支持的想法还被导师毙了“那你能力不足还是回来做经验导航吧”。但我这段时间一直在改那个vln的内容,想做出来仿真试试看有没有效果,但我没跟任何人提起过。⭐⭐⭐想毕业后去国企工作(主要是感觉相对来说不卷和稳定,考公实在是太难,而且都是考公不异地,但我不想扎根我那个小地方,28岁毕业大龄研究生去民营企业可能也不太好卷)⭐⭐⭐但是一点也不了解国企相关企业和岗位以及要求,也不知道研一研二除了看论文和复现能干什么(不放实习),vla等也没实力做也纯开荒,求助🙏🙏请各位大佬:1.国企哪些单位岗位可能会适合我去(无主要干部经历,有d员,无表彰)2.这些岗位需要具备什么样的技能3.如果有懂得话麻烦指点一下我现在的需要学习的内容的方向4.或者苏州上海有没有什么可能会适合我假期去短期实习的公司也可以建议一下,万分感谢🙏🏻
点赞 评论 收藏
分享
评论
3
13
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务